Tonight sees our lads play their internationals. As usual we keep fingers crossed that everyone comes back in good shape. There’ll be a lot of focus on England v Spain as Cesc Fabregas goes up against Steven Gerrard and Frank Lampard. The young Spaniard won’t shirk the physical side of it though, saying:

It will be tough because we know how England can play. It will be tough but we think we can beat them. If England try to rough us up, we can handle that. Definitely.

Last night Justin Hoyte and Theo Walcott figured for England’s U21s as they came back from 2-0 down to draw 2-2 with their Spanish counterparts while Gilberto played for Brazil v Portugal at the Grove.

Congratulations to Tomas Rosicky who was named the Czech player of the year for the third time. He credits moving to Arsenal with improving him as a player and he’s happy with how things are going so far, promising to improve even more. He says:

I hoped I would do well and I am very happy that I play regularly, that I have gained ground there this quickly. The Premiership is very quick, but I believe I will be even better.

He does seem to have grown into the team since Christmas and the way we need to see him improve now is with goals. I know you can’t really call him a direct replacement for Robert Pires but the team certainly misses Pires’ goals. If Rosicky could get a half dozen between now and the end of the season it would set him up nicely for next year and certainly have a big impact on results.
